Job Description
Join the UK’s number one fitness brand and favourite gym as a Personal Trainer / Fitness Coach.
Keep 100% of your PT earnings; your first month is rent free.
Why be a self‑employed Personal Trainer at Pure Gym? You will have access to the largest member base in the UK, plus:
- Access to an exclusive app with industry‑leading content.
- Free education and CIMSPA accredited courses all bespoke to Pure Gym, with unlimited access to business resources.
- Access to the best fitness discounts exclusive to PG Personal Trainers.
- Free webinars, podcasts and access to our mentoring lab – you can be mentored on all aspects of your business.
- Wellness package – online GP, counselling sessions, physio sessions & financial guidance.
- PT support – 5x free guest passes per month, lead generation workshops, PT open week for you to generate leads & PT taster sessions on the timetable for members to discover you.
- Full rent transition programme delivered by master trainers.
- Free advertising on the Pure Gym website, social media and in club.
Benefits as a Fitness Coach
- Contracted salary, guaranteed 12 hours per week.
- Annual leave allowance, plus a personal day off.
- Free gym membership for yourself and a friend or family member.
- Employee assistance programme.
- Pension scheme.
- Discounted legal services.
- Enhanced maternity & paternity leave.
- Funded first aid qualification.
- Career development with management training programmes.
- Group exercise initial training and continual up‑skill opportunities.
In your role as a Fitness Coach, you will play a key part in the safe enjoyment of our gyms, delivering an amazing member experience, teaching classes, inductions, and taking care of the upkeep of the gym floor.
